Autonomous Seasonal Inventory Replenishment and Demand Forecasting

For a fireworks retailer, inventory is highly perishable in terms of seasonal demand. Overstocking leads to high storage costs, while understocking results in lost revenue during the critical July 4th and New Year windows. Current manual forecasting often relies on legacy spreadsheets that fail to account for local demographic shifts or weather-related demand fluctuations. By leveraging AI to predict demand at the stand level, businesses can optimize stock levels across their 10 locations, reducing capital tied up in slow-moving inventory and ensuring high-margin items are always available when customers arrive.

Up to 20% reduction in overstockRetail Inventory Optimization Standards
The agent ingests historical sales data, local weather forecasts, and regional event calendars. It continuously monitors real-time sales at the Superstore and individual stands via the POS system. When stock levels hit defined thresholds, the agent generates automated purchase orders for suppliers. It identifies underperforming SKUs and suggests dynamic price adjustments to ensure inventory clearance, effectively acting as a 24/7 supply chain manager that minimizes human error in ordering.

Automated Regulatory Compliance and Permitting Documentation

Fireworks retail is subject to stringent local and state fire marshal regulations. Managing permits, safety inspections, and compliance documentation for 11 separate locations is a significant administrative burden. Failure to maintain precise records can lead to fines or temporary closure of stands, which is catastrophic during peak season. AI agents can centralize compliance tracking, ensuring that every stand has the necessary documentation, insurance certificates, and fire safety protocols in place, reducing the risk of human error in document management and streamlining the renewal process with local authorities.

40% reduction in administrative compliance timePublic Sector Operational Efficiency Benchmarks
This agent acts as a compliance watchdog. It monitors permit expiration dates, schedules required safety inspections, and auto-populates renewal forms using existing company data. It integrates with digital document repositories to ensure the latest certificates are available for site managers. If a discrepancy is detected—such as an expired fire extinguisher tag or a missing permit—the agent alerts management immediately, providing a clear path to resolution before an inspector arrives.

AI-Driven Seasonal Workforce Onboarding and Scheduling

Managing a temporary, seasonal workforce for 11 sites is complex. Hiring, training, and scheduling staff for short, high-intensity periods often leads to high turnover and operational friction. Standard manual scheduling fails to account for employee performance, proximity to stands, or local labor availability. AI can optimize the deployment of seasonal staff by matching employee skills and availability to peak traffic hours, reducing labor waste and ensuring that the most experienced staff are present during the busiest times at the Superstore.

15-20% improvement in labor utilizationSeasonal Workforce Management Reports
The agent manages the full lifecycle of seasonal staff. It parses applications, conducts initial skill screenings, and automates the onboarding process. During the season, it uses predictive traffic models to adjust shift schedules in real-time, ensuring optimal coverage at the Superstore and stands. It handles time-off requests and shift swaps autonomously, providing managers with a dashboard of labor costs versus revenue generated per site.
